Purchase Contracts
You use the Purchase Contracts application to maintain purchase contracts with outside vendors. On the contract, you can specify items or services provided and their costs, shipping and handling, expected delivery times, financial terms, and vendor information.
You can create the following types of purchase contracts:
- Blanket contract - A blanket contract is an agreement to spend a predetermined amount with the specified vendor over a period of time.
- Price contract - A price contract specifies that items or services purchased from the specified vendor over a period of time are provided at an agreed-upon price.
- Purchase contract - A purchase contract is an agreement to purchase items or services at an agreed-upon price with a vendor. To create this type of contract, you must have a purchase order that does not specify a maximum amount.
Before you can approve a purchase contract, you must have at least one authorized site.
